    Principal Hardware Engineer - Satellite Communications | Loughborough, UK | Hybrid | £70,000 - £100,000

    Lynx is working with leading technology company, which is seeking a talented Principal Hardware Engineer to drive the design and development of cutting-edge satellite communications payload architecture. This is an exciting opportunity to make a significant impact in the rapidly evolving space industry while working with a dedicated and passionate team.

    Responsibilities:

    • Define and design next-generation payload computer product requirements and conduct meticulous trade-offs
    • Design complex high-speed digital/analogue circuit boards for pre-production prototypes
    • Procure and integrate evaluation modules and reference designs to complete proof-of-concept operations
    • Collaborate closely with international satellite development teams across various disciplines
    • Actively contribute to and lead the payload computer roadmap
    • Prepare comprehensive documentation for design reviews and effectively communicate technical information to diverse audiences

    Requirements:

    • Extensive experience in electronics hardware design, including analysis, simulation, schematic capture, PCB layout, and testing
    • Proven experience in leading the design and development of complex communications systems
    • Design experience with complex Microprocessor/DSP devices and on-board high-speed data buses
    • Proficiency in circuit analysis using suitable simulation tools
    • Hands-on problem-solving skills using test equipment
    • Experience with the full V-Model design cycle, from requirement capture through to design verification
